A tragedy occurred in the town of Pertuis, in the Vaucluse, this Tuesday.

A 3-year-old child drowned in the Durance, a hundred meters from his home, reports

La Provence

.

It was around 5:45 p.m. when the emergency services were alerted.

Dispatched to the scene, at the level of the municipal road of Iscles du Mulet, rescuers and specialized divers pulled the young victim out of the water.

They tried to resuscitate the little boy, in vain.

His death was soon pronounced.

An open investigation

The circumstances of the drowning are unknown at this time.

A police investigation has been opened to shed light on this tragedy.

The Pertuis company is in charge of the investigations.
